Yes, it's always half fat to flour so
1/2lb of flour
1/4lb fat - you can use lard (or half lard half butter) - or all butter if you're feeling well off.
little pinch of salt
add enough water to make into a firm dough to roll out.
Don't forget cold hands!
For a beef one, I use suet instead of lard, and pour a drop of the gravy on top to keep it moist while it cooks, yummy!
